Output 8869fe31dc1332a4d548385154f9b164eec957b1bafdd4b4a8395836d4567eee:0
- value
- 63874090
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d91f16f1215b7998bda39150b0ae65a40f79981
- address
- bc1qhkglzmcjzkmenz768y2skzhxtfq00xvpug4sjr
- transaction
- 8869fe31dc1332a4d548385154f9b164eec957b1bafdd4b4a8395836d4567eee
- confirmations
- 320888
- spent
- true